EnCharge AI launched in 2022 and is led by veteran technologists with backgrounds in semiconductor design and AI systems. ## About the Role EnCharge AI is looking for a highly motivated and experienced Staff Physical Design Engineer to drive the physical implementation of our next-generation semiconductor chips. In this role, you will play a critical part in translating complex microarchitectures into high-performance, power-efficient silicon. Working closely with cross-functional teams, you will own block-level and top-level implementation using industry-standard EDA tools, tackle complex timing closure and power challenges, and guide designs all the way from netlist to successful foundry tapeout. ## Key Responsibilities - Drive block-level and top-level physical design, including floor-planning, placement, clock tree synthesis (CTS), and routing. - Achieve aggressive timing, power, and area (PPA) targets through advanced timing closure techniques. - Perform power grid verification and manage electromigration and IR drop (EM/IR) analysis and resolution. - Develop and maintain automation scripts (Tcl/Python) to streamline design flows and methodologies. - Collaborate with physical verification and foundry teams to ensure design rule compliance and successful tapeout execution. ## Qualifications and Requirements - Bachelor's or Master’s degree in Electrical Engineering, Computer Engineering, or a related field. - 10–15 years of dedicated experience in physical design. - Strong understanding of EDA implementation flows with extensive experience using Cadence design tools. - Deep understanding of static timing analysis (STA) concepts and advanced timing closure methodologies. - Demonstrated success in top-level and block-level physical design, with hierarchical floorplanning expertise a strong plus. - Proficiency in low-power design techniques, debugging, and EM/IR check resolution/power grid verification. - Strong scripting skills in Tcl or Python for design flow automation. - Solid understanding of advanced process nodes and physical verification requirements associated with routing. - Experience with physical design methodology, flow setup, and advanced flow evaluations. - Prior experience with PDK management or foundry tapeout processes is highly desirable. Actual compensation offered will be determined based on job-related knowledge, skills, and experience. ## About EnCharge AI ## Company Overview - **One-liner**: EnCharge AI develops analog in-memory computing hardware and software to deliver high-efficiency, low-cost AI inference from edge devices to cloud data centers. - **Entity Type**: Private (Series B – II stage) - **Headquarters**: Santa Clara, California, United States - **Founded**: 2022 - **Founders**: Naveen Verma, Ph.D. (CEO) and Kailash Gopalakrishnan, Ph.D. (CTO) ## Core Business - **Primary industry**: AI semiconductor hardware and embedded software products - **Target customers**: B2B – enterprises deploying AI at scale, edge-device manufacturers, cloud service providers, and defense/industrial sectors - **Mission**: Democratize advanced AI by enabling deployment beyond cloud infrastructure to local servers and mobile devices, while slashing costs and environmental impact ## Products & Services - **Analog In-Memory Computing GPUs & Digital AI Accelerators**: Custom silicon (chiplets, ASICs) and standard-form-factor PCIe cards that perform AI inference using analog computation for orders-of-magnitude better energy efficiency and compute density. - **Software Stack**: Seamless orchestration layer that supports on-device and cloud deployment, enabling model portability, quantization, and compiler optimizations across EnCharge’s hardware. - **Edge-to-Cloud Platforms**: Integrated solutions for power-, space-, and cost-constrained environments, covering autonomous systems, smart devices, data center inference, and private on-premise AI. ## Market Standing - **Valuation / Market Cap**: Not publicly disclosed - **Key Metrics**: Annual Revenue ~$10M (LinkedIn estimate) | Total Funding $162.9M - **Notable Investors & Partners**: Tiger Global Management (led $100M Series B, Mar 2025), Anzu Partners (led $21.7M Series A, Dec 2022), DARPA ($18.6M grant, Mar 2024), and others including corporate/institutional backers. - **Growth Signals**: - 58.6% YoY headcount growth (75 employees, as of mid-2025) - 39 active job openings spanning hardware, compiler, and AI architecture roles - 150+ patents granted, 300+ technical publications - Talent inflows from Intel, IBM, Cerebras, AMD, Meta, Microsoft ## Competitive Advantages - **Analog In-Memory Computing Moa**t: A proprietary compute architecture that uses charge-domain analog circuits, validated silicon, and leverages existing semiconductor supply chains. - **Record Efficiency**: Claims 20× higher TOPS/W, 9× higher compute density (TOPS/mm²), 10× lower total cost of ownership, and 100× lower CO₂ emissions compared to leading cloud/GPU alternatives. - **Deep IP Portfolio**: 150+ granted patents and 300+ publications from 20+ years of foundational research by the founding team (Princeton, IBM, etc.). - **End-to-End Solution**: Full-stack hardware and software (compiler, quantization, runtime) designed for seamless edge-to-cloud orchestration without vendor lock-in. ## Strategic Focus - Scale production and customer deployments of their analog in-memory compute chips for high-volume edge and data center inference. - Expand software ecosystem to support mainstream AI frameworks (PyTorch, TensorFlow, ONNX) and enable easy drop-in replacement for existing GPU-accelerated workloads. - Deepen partnerships with defense (DARPA) and enterprise cloud providers, emphasizing data privacy, security, and sustainability. - Double down on sustainability messaging (100× lower CO₂) to meet ESG mandates in enterprise AI procurement. ## Why Work Here - **Mission-Driven Impact**: Opportunity to make AI accessible to the “99%” by dramatically reducing energy and cost barriers.
